# Scrivener Compile

You help the writer turn a `.scriv` project into a single finished document —
the **Compile** step, where the Draft's documents are assembled in binder order
into a manuscript. Compile is **read-only** for the project: it reads the binder
and writes a new output file; it never mutates the `.scriv`.

This is the place to get a *structured* manuscript: titles become headings, the
documents flow in order, and items flagged out of the compile are skipped. For
the raw words of one document (no structure), route to **scrivener-extract**.

## Compiling to Markdown or plain text (available now)

`compile` assembles the Draft (the `DraftFolder`, whatever it is renamed to) in
binder order. It turns each item's **title into a heading by its depth** (a
top-level item → `#`, its child → `##`, and so on) and **honors
`IncludeInCompile`** — items flagged out are skipped.

```bash
# Compile the whole Draft to Markdown (default)
python3 ${CLAUDE_PLUGIN_ROOT}/tools/scrivener/cli.py compile \
  --to md --project "<path.scriv>"

# Compile to plain text
python3 ${CLAUDE_PLUGIN_ROOT}/tools/scrivener/cli.py compile \
  --to txt --project "<path.scriv>"

# Compile only one container (e.g. a single Part/folder) by UUID
python3 ${CLAUDE_PLUGIN_ROOT}/tools/scrivener/cli.py compile \
  --to md --group <uuid> --project "<path.scriv>"
```

Output is JSON by default (the assembled document plus a manifest of which items
were included or skipped). Add `--format text` for the assembled document alone.
Items with no body text (folders, empty documents, Image items) contribute their
**title heading** but no paragraph text; that is normal, not an error.

**Titles are not unique.** When the user names the group to compile, run `find`
(see scrivener-inspect) first and pass the **UUID** to `--group` if more than one
item matches.

## The compile model is bounded — say so

Scrivener's real Compile binds each document's **section type** to a **section
layout** (from a chosen compile **Format**), and the layout is what controls
title prefixes/suffixes, numbering (`Chapter <$n>`), separators, page breaks, and
heading levels. **Those layout definitions do not live inside the `.scriv`** —
`Settings/compile.xml` stores only the section-type → layout-ID *mapping*; the
actual definitions live in app-level stock Formats / `.scrformat` files outside
the project.

Be honest with the writer: because the definitions are external, a faithful
compile is **bounded and approximate**. The v0.1.0 `compile`:

- assembles in binder order, honors Include-in-Compile, and maps **title → ATX
  heading by binder depth** — a sensible, predictable approximation;
- does **not** yet read `compile.xml`, apply section-type → layout, add title
  prefixes/numbering, insert separators, or run compile-time replacements.

If the user expects the exact output of a specific Scrivener compile Format, tell
them this toolkit approximates it rather than reproducing the external layout
definitions. See `references/compile-model.md` for the full inputs and the
bounded-approximation note.

## Rich formats are engine-gated (planned)

Markdown, plain text (and, planned, HTML) are produced with the Python standard
library — always available. Richer outputs require an **external engine** and are
**planned**, gated, and degrade gracefully when the engine is absent:

| Output | Engine | Status |
|---|---|---|
| `--to md` / `--to txt` | stdlib | ✅ available now |
| `--to html` | stdlib | 🔜 planned |
| `--to docx` / `--to odt` / `--to epub` | pandoc | 🔜 planned (needs pandoc) |
| `--to pdf` | LaTeX (pdflatex) or native print | 🔜 planned (engine-gated) |
| `--to fountain` | stdlib (scripts) | 🔜 planned |

When asked for a planned format, say it isn't in the CLI yet and offer the
closest path: **compile to Markdown now**, then convert with pandoc/LaTeX
yourself, or wait for the gated engine support. Never claim a docx/epub/pdf
compile succeeded when the engine isn't wired up.

## Safety

Compile is read-only — it writes a *new* output file and never modifies the
`.scriv`, so no backup or snapshot is taken. Even so, remind the writer to
**close the project in Scrivener** and let **cloud sync (Dropbox/iCloud) finish**
before compiling a live project, so you read a consistent on-disk state.
`docs.checksum` mismatches are advisory and never block a compile.
